Meg Cabot is a well-known author celebrated for her engaging and relatable writing style, particularly in the young adult and contemporary romance genres. Her most notable work is the “Princess Diaries” series, which follows the life of Mia Thermopolis, a teenager who unexpectedly learns she is the heir to a European throne. The series captures the ups and downs of adolescence while incorporating themes of identity, friendship, and love, appealing to both young readers and adults. Cabot's storytelling is marked by humor and authenticity, as she often draws on her own life experiences. She has a knack for creating memorable characters that resonate with her audience, making her books popular across various age groups. Beyond the “Princess Diaries,” she has written numerous other novels and series that explore themes such as personal growth and self-discovery. In addition to her fiction work, Meg Cabot contributes to various genres, including graphic novels and adult fiction. Her ability to connect with readers through relatable scenarios and engaging dialogue has solidified her status as a beloved author. Cabot continues to inspire young readers and avid book lovers alike with her captivating narratives and powerful female protagonists. Born in Bloomington, Indiana, Cabot has a background in fine arts and has turned her passion for writing into a successful career. Her works often draw on her experiences, making them feel authentic and relatable. As a prolific writer, Cabot has penned numerous bestselling novels, captivating audiences with her humor and insights into teenage life. Her contributions to literature, especially in the young adult genre, continue to influence readers around the world.
